B2-01 Establishment of separation and supply system for collected plastics in cooperation with local governments

Principal Investigator

MIYAHARA Nobuo(AMITA Holdings Co.)

Background and Purpose

  • Develop a system for sorting and supplying collected plastics in collaboration with residents and municipalities to ensure a low-cost, stable supply of high-quality recycled materials.
  • Establish a circular model for plastics that focuses on collection and recycling based on manufacturers’ demand, rather than the traditional emission-based recycling system. This aims to create a domestic cycle of high-quality resources and evaluate the effectiveness of resource-collection sites with resident cooperation, as a stable supply source of plastics.
  • Demonstrate a sorting center with functions to store, gather, inspect collected plastics, reduce the volume of plastics, convert them into information, and develop a method to provide traceability information for PLA-NETJ (Plastic Networking for Environmental Transformation Japan) concept.
  • Utilize social impact evaluation methods to visualize the resolution of local challenges and the improvement of residents’ well-being. This includes benefits beyond the environmental domain, such as enhancing health and creating spaces for children by promoting communication through the collection sites.
